Understanding RFID Technology and Its Applications in Event Management

RFID technology is transforming event management. It uses radio waves to transfer data between a reader and a tag. This enables seamless tracking of attendees, assets, and even access control. By employing Elastic RFID wristbands, organizers streamline entry processes, reducing wait times for guests. These wristbands can store essential information, allowing for a more personalized experience.

In addition to enhancing efficiency, RFID applications promote safety. Specific wristbands can instantly identify individuals who require special attention. However, the technology is not flawless. Issues like signal interference and data privacy concerns need careful consideration. Implementing strong security measures is crucial when using RFID systems. Event organizers must prioritize attendee trust to ensure successful adoption.

Moreover, while RFID provides many advantages, not every event may benefit from it. Small gatherings or informal meetups might find traditional ticketing sufficient. Analyzing the specific needs of an event can lead to better decisions. Balancing innovation with practicality is essential for successful event planning.

Benefits of Using Elastic RFID Wristbands for Event Access Control

Elastic RFID wristbands have become increasingly popular for event access control. They offer a range of benefits that enhance both security and guest experience. These wristbands are lightweight and comfortable, making them easy to wear throughout the day. Their flexibility accommodates various wrist sizes, ensuring that almost anyone can wear them without discomfort.

One significant advantage is their ability to streamline entry processes. With RFID technology, attendees can simply scan their wristband to gain access. This reduces long queues and wait times, creating a more enjoyable experience for everyone. Additionally, these wristbands can be customized with designs or colors, adding a fun element to the event.

Tips for choosing the right RFID wristband include ensuring durability and water resistance. You want a wristband that can withstand different environments and not fall apart easily. Also, consider the range of RFID technologies available. Some options support cashless transactions, while others only handle entry control. Choosing the right features will ultimately enhance the overall event experience.

Another important factor is the integration with your event management system. Ensure that the wristbands you choose can easily connect with the software you’re using. Compatibility will save you headaches and ensure smooth operations. Always test the setup before the actual event to catch any potential issues early on.
